Quarterly Planning Note — Divestiture of the Coastal Tooling Unit

For the finance team: the sale of the Coastal Tooling unit to Pellmark Industries remains on track for close in Q3. Please finalize the carve-out balance sheet, reconcile intercompany positions, and prepare the working-capital adjustment schedule by month-end. Audit support requests should be prioritized. For planning purposes, note the following sensitive item:

internal memo for hawef-kahif: The finance team signed off on a budget of $25.9 million for Project Sorox. The renewal with Pelokek Logistics closes at $51.7 million a year, 52 percent below the last contract.

Alert: CronDrift-Watch fired three times this week on the Pellmarsh scheduler. Jobs are starting up to 40s late; suspected clock skew on node pool C after the last image rollout. Investigation ongoing; no customer impact confirmed yet. Findings, timeline, and next steps for the eng sync are tracked on the internal page.

runbook for tafof-yawif: https://confluence.tolvaqsys.internal/display/display/browse/pages/7be3

The Driftshard service manages shard assignment for the Oakmere user-profile store. Each profile write is routed by hashing the account ID against the active ring, published at `/v2/ring`. During a reshard, the on-call engineer should poll `/v2/ring/status` until rebalancing completes. All ring endpoints require the internal Driftshard service key in the `Authorization` header, shown below:

service key, kaduf-bawig: kto15_Ze79S0dligTw0yO

### Changelog — 2024-03-02

Rotated the signing key for FareForge, our shipping-fee rules engine, as part of quarterly hygiene. Rule bundles published after today are signed with the new key; old bundles remain verifiable until month end. CI verification jobs updated on the Delvane runners. No rule logic changed. For reference at the sync, the new key is below.

signing key of bagap-yawep = bky13_TbfT6ZMUoGJo2

## Provenance: Gateway Rate Limiting

The Thornvale internal gateway now enforces per-tenant rate limits at build time via baked-in policy bundles. For release sign-off, confirm the policy bundle hash matches the provenance record before promotion; mismatches indicate an unverified build. The current promotion candidate's token is listed below.

pipeline stamp: htk31_f769b577b3028a4e9958e5bb8d1259a